Player Story
Ronnie Hickman built his college career from 2019 through 2022 as a safety from Wayne, NJ wearing No. 14, spending time with Ohio State. The clearest part of Ronnie Hickman's career was his defensive production: 154 tackles, 2.5 tackles for loss, 1 sack, and 3 interceptions across 26 career games in the available record. His largest box-score season came in 2021 with Ohio State. Those numbers show where he fit, how often the ball or action found him, and how his role developed over time.
